Vertex Attributes
Shape
from sp_graph_layout import (
AttributeRankDir,
AttributeShape,
DirectedGraphHierarchicalLayout,
)
layout = DirectedGraphHierarchicalLayout()
graph = layout.create_graph(3)
graph.add_edges([[0, 1], [1, 2], [2, 0]])
layout.attributes().set_vertex_shape(0, AttributeShape.DOUBLE_CIRCLE)
layout.attributes().set_vertex_shape(1, AttributeShape.RECT)
layout.attributes().set_vertex_shape(2, AttributeShape.ELLIPSE)
layout.attributes().set_rank_dir(AttributeRankDir.LEFT_TO_RIGHT)
layout.init_vertex_labels_with_numerical_values(0)
layout.layout_graph()
svg = layout.render()

Label
from sp_graph_layout import (
AttributeRankDir,
AttributeShape,
DirectedGraphHierarchicalLayout,
)
layout = DirectedGraphHierarchicalLayout()
graph = layout.create_graph(3)
graph.add_edges([[0, 1], [1, 2], [2, 0]])
layout.set_vertex_labels(["Eat", "Sleep", "Play"])
for u in range(3):
layout.attributes().set_vertex_shape(u, AttributeShape.ELLIPSE)
layout.attributes().set_rank_dir(AttributeRankDir.LEFT_TO_RIGHT)
layout.layout_graph()
svg = layout.render()
